Let's start with a customer complaint, one we've all felt. "I drove all the way there, and they were closed!" This simple frustration is often the direct result of a business neglecting its digital storefront. For us as small business owners, this isn't just an interesting piece of data; it's a massive, flashing neon sign pointing directly to our greatest opportunity: Local Search Engine Optimization (Local SEO).
We're not talking about competing with Amazon or global megacorporations. We're talking about being the top choice for the people in our own community who are actively looking for the products and services we offer. It’s about turning those "near me" searches into real foot traffic and tangible revenue. In this guide, we'll break down the what, why, and how of building a local SEO strategy that puts your business on the digital map.
Demystifying Local SEO: The Core Concepts
Think of Local SEO as the digital equivalent of putting up a great sign, having a clean storefront, and being listed in the local phone book—all rolled into one powerful strategy for the internet age.
When a user performs a search like “best pizza in Brooklyn” or “mechanic near me,” search engines use get more info their location to provide results that are geographically relevant. These results often appear in what's known as the "Map Pack" or "Local Pack"—that prominent box with a map and three business listings right at the top of the search results page. Getting into that box is the primary goal.
Why does it matter so much? Research from BrightLocal indicates that 97% of consumers learn more about a local company online than anywhere else. If you’re not visible online, for a huge portion of your potential customers, you simply don’t exist.
"The beauty of local SEO is that it allows small businesses to compete with the big guys. You don't need a national budget to be the #1 result for a customer searching a mile away from your door." – Sarah Johnson, Digital Marketing Consultant
Each listing, content update, or local campaign we launch is crafted by the OnlineKhadamate team with attention to local intent and structured optimization. Rather than generic SEO strategies, our approach emphasizes data-backed decisions based on actual user behavior in regional search. We make sure every signal — from title tags to business hours — is aligned with what people expect when they search for local services. This helps establish a dependable presence that performs not just in general SERPs but in the critical map-based and near-me search space where competition is different and expectations are higher.
What Makes Google Rank a Local Business?
Google's local algorithm is a complex beast, but it boils down to three core pillars: Relevance, Proximity, and Prominence. To succeed, we need to send strong signals in all three areas.
Here’s a breakdown of the most critical factors:
- Google Business Profile (GBP) Signals: This is your most important local SEO tool. The completeness of your profile, the accuracy of your information, the categories you select, and the volume of photos all play a massive role.
- On-Page SEO Signals: This refers to the content on your actual website. Signals like having your Name, Address, and Phone number (NAP) clearly visible, optimizing your title tags with local keywords, and building out service pages for each neighborhood you serve are crucial.
- Citation & Link Signals: Citations are mentions of your business's NAP on other websites (like Yelp, Yellow Pages, or industry-specific directories). Consistency is king here. Local backlinks from other local businesses or community sites also build your authority.
- Review Signals: The number, frequency, and quality of your online reviews are a huge trust signal. Google wants to see a steady stream of positive reviews on your GBP and other platforms.
- Behavioral Signals: This includes data on how users interact with your listing. High click-through rates, mobile clicks-to-call, and requests for driving directions all signal to Google that your business is a popular and relevant choice.
A Practical Step-by-Step Local SEO Marketing Strategy
The key is to be methodical. Here’s a blueprint for getting started.
- Claim & Super-Optimize Your Google Business Profile: This is step zero. Go to
google.com/business
and claim or create your listing. Fill out every single section: services, products, Q&A, business description, and consistently upload high-quality photos and use Google Posts. - Conduct Hyper-Local Keyword Research: Get specific with your keywords. Brainstorm terms that include your service, your city, and even your neighborhood or zip code.
- Localize Your Website:
- Ensure your NAP is identical to your GBP and is present in your website's footer or header.
- Create dedicated pages for your most important services and mention the specific areas you serve.
- Write blog posts about local events, news, or guides that are relevant to your customers.
- Build a Foundation of Citations: The goal is to make sure your business's Name, Address, and Phone number are listed identically everywhere online. For this, many marketers use a combination of manual submissions and managed services. Resources from hubs like Search Engine Journal and guidance from established agencies such as Neil Patel Digital or Online Khadamate, a company with deep roots in SEO and web design, all stress the foundational importance of clean citations. An observation from the team at Online Khadamate suggests that meticulously cleaning up inconsistent or old citation data is one of the highest-impact initial actions a local business can take.
- Develop a Review Generation System: Actively ask for reviews. Make it easy for happy customers by sending them a direct link to your GBP review section via email or text after a successful transaction.
Case Study in Action: "Brenda's Bakery"
Let's look at a hypothetical but realistic example. Brenda's Bakery is a small, family-owned shop in Austin, Texas.
- The Problem: Despite having delicious pastries, they were invisible online. A search for "bakery in south austin" brought up three major chain stores.
- The Strategy:
- They fully optimized their GBP with mouth-watering photos, a full menu under "Products," and used Google Posts to announce daily specials.
- They updated their website to include "South Austin's Favorite Bakery" in the title tag and created a page about their custom-designed wedding cakes for Austin-area weddings.
- They used a service to get listed correctly on 50 key local directories.
- They placed a small, simple sign at their checkout counter with a QR code linking directly to their Google review page.
- The Results (Over 6 Months):
- Ranked #2 in the Local Pack for "bakery in south austin."
- Online-driven foot traffic (measured by "get directions" clicks) increased by 45%.
- Phone calls from their GBP listing more than doubled.
This is the kind of tangible result that local SEO can deliver. Professionals at marketing consultancies and even freelance strategists, like those who follow the detailed guides on Ahrefs' blog, consistently replicate this process for their clients. It's about diligent, focused execution.
Comparing Local SEO Efforts: Impact vs. Difficulty
To help prioritize, let’s compare some core local SEO activities.
Activity | Potential Impact | Estimated Difficulty |
---|---|---|
GBP Optimization | Very High | Low |
On-Page Localization | High | Medium |
Review Generation | High | Medium |
Local Link Building | Very High | High |
Citation Cleanup & Building | Medium | Low (with tools) |
Frequently Asked Questions (FAQs)
Q1: Is local SEO a quick fix? Patience is crucial. While some quick wins like GBP optimization can show an impact in weeks, climbing to the top of competitive search results is a long-term project that typically takes several months. Q2: Can I do local SEO myself, or do I need to hire an agency? You can absolutely start with the basics yourself! Optimizing your GBP and managing reviews are great starting points. As you scale, or if you're in a highly competitive market, partnering with a specialist or agency can provide the expertise and resources to get you to the next level. Q3: How much does local SEO cost? The cost varies wildly. DIY efforts cost only your time. Tools can range from $30 to $150 per month. Hiring a freelancer or agency can range from a few hundred to several thousand dollars per month, depending on the scope of work and competition.Your Local SEO Launch Checklist
- Claim and fully complete your Google Business Profile.
- Find your top 5 local and service-based keywords.
- Add your full Name, Address, and Phone Number (NAP) to your website's footer.
- Check your business on 10 major directories (Yelp, Foursquare, etc.) for NAP consistency.
- Create a plan to ask every happy customer for a review.
- Upload at least 10 new, high-quality photos to your GBP.
- Write and publish your first Google Post.
Conclusion: Your Community is Searching
Ultimately, local SEO is about connection. It's about making sure that when someone in your community needs you, they can find you easily. By methodically optimizing your digital presence, you're not just playing a game with an algorithm; you're building a more resilient, visible, and successful local business. The search is happening right now, just outside your door. It's time to get found.
About the Author Michael Chen, M.Sc. is a senior marketing analyst with over 14 years of experience helping small and medium-sized businesses navigate the complexities of online marketing. Holding a Master of Science in Data Analytics, Michael specializes in search engine optimization and conversion rate optimization. His work involves analyzing user behavior data to inform evidence-based marketing strategies. He has managed campaigns for over 100 businesses, from local service providers to regional e-commerce stores, and frequently contributes to industry blogs on the topic of data-centric marketing.